Variety and Selection: Meeting Every Task and Environment
Different workplaces and tasks necessitate different trolley specifications. There is a broad spectrum of hand trolleys, each engineered to fit particular applications. For lighter loads or frequent travel over smooth surfaces, aluminium models are an excellent choice due to their corrosion resistance and ease of handling. For heavier or industrial loads, steel-framed trolleys provide the additional strength required.
Folding hand trucks offer compact storage options suitable for smaller spaces or vehicle transport. Specialised designs like stair climbers incorporate extra wheels that allow safer and easier navigation on stairs, invaluable for delivery or moving appliances in multi-level buildings.
When selecting among these options, consider the type of load, surface conditions and storage logistics. Trolleys come in varied weight limits designed to accommodate everything from small parcels to bulk goods. Wheels come in different types too, like hard rubber or pneumatic, to suit surfaces ranging from smooth concrete to rough outdoor terrain. Handle shape and grip style also influence usability, especially when operating trolleys over extended periods.

Important Considerations When Deciding to Add One in Your Inventory
Choosing a hand trolley involves several practical factors beyond basic specifications. Consider the primary use case: will it be handling heavy boxes, bulky appliances, gas cylinders, or multiple smaller items? This will dictate the size and configuration needed. For example, tall, narrow trolleys suit long items or cylinder transport, while wide flat bases accommodate boxes or appliances.
The durability of construction materials impacts both the lifespan and maintenance of the trolley. Aluminium models resist rust and heat better, making them ideal for wet or outdoor conditions, while steel provides ruggedness for demanding warehouse environments.
Mobility and ergonomics are crucial for reducing operator fatigue. Look for trolleys with cushioned or moulded grips and wheels that absorb shock or handle uneven surfaces smoothly. Pneumatic tyres may add versatility outdoors but require more upkeep than solid wheels.
Storage space and portability also matter. Folding trolleys enable easy stowing in vehicles or crowded workspaces without compromising load capacity significantly. Maintenance tips include regular inspection of wheels and axles for wear, tightening bolts and cleaning to prevent rust or dirt buildup. Proper handling and storage prolong the equipment’s functional life and ensure safety in daily use.
Versatile Uses and Care Tips

While commonly used in warehousing, delivery and retail sectors, hand trolleys also excel in specialised tasks. They facilitate transporting gas cylinders safely by providing secure frame designs and supports to prevent tipping. Moving large appliances or delicate electronics becomes more manageable, reducing the risk of damage during transit.
Many trolleys are designed with versatility in mind, able to transform between different loading configurations or adjust heights to suit diverse tasks. This adaptability makes them a valuable asset for businesses facing varying shipment sizes and types.
Routine maintenance such as cleaning wheels from debris, lubricating moving parts and storing trolleys in dry conditions extends their efficiency and safety. Avoiding overloading protects structural integrity and reduces the risk of accidents. Employing these care tips helps get maximum performance and service life, ensuring the trolley remains a dependable piece of equipment.
